Skip to Main Content

TALK OF THE TOWN Languages & Culture

Category Education

Address


Belmont Neighborhood
Charlottesville, VA 22902
(434) 218-3678

visit website

View on Google Maps

Nearby Dining
Nearby Shopping
Nearby Arts, Culture, and Entertainment